What is customer relationship management?

Intercom, Inc.

Customer relationship management (CRM) is a strategy and methodology that revolves around using data and feedback to build authentic, meaningful relationships with prospects and customers, keeping them connected and loyal to your company. This process is called customer relationship marketing.

CEMs vs. CRMs (And Why You Need Both)

PeopleMetrics

Customer Experience Management (CEM) and Customer Relationship Management (CRM) are the same, right?”. While it may be true that at their core, both systems revolve around the key interactions a customer has with your brand, CRMs and CEMs serve distinctly different purposes and operate from two contrasting angles.
